Bungulla
Locality
Bungulla is a small town located on the Great Eastern Highway in the central Wheatbelt region of Western Australia. In the 2021 Australian census, the area has been listed as South Tammin and registered a population of 126. Bungulla is situated 3 km south of Bungulla Nature Reserve.
